Biography

Jessica Southwell graduated from the University of Central Florida with degrees in film and dance. Jessica grew up training and performing in tap, jazz, ballet, hip hop, gymnastics, aerial silks, and ballroom. She now lives in Los Angeles, CA specializing in both vintage and contemporary dance styles while training and teaching internationally. Most recently Jessica can be seen in music videos and performances with Scott Bradlee's Post Modern Jukebox. In 2016 Jessica performed as a lead dancer in SWING! the Broadway Musical with Norwegian Cruise Lines. She has taught master classes for UCLA, Savannah College of Art and Design, Stetson University, University of Alabama, Florida State University, University of Central Florida, and Eastern Florida State College. Jessica taught dance, gymnastics, and aerial silks for six years as the Assistant Director of Brevard Arts Academy. She has also taught regularly for Starz Dance Galaxy, East Coast gymnastics, Sarah's School of Dance, and University Performing Arts Center in Central Florida. From 2010-2015 Jessica performed professionally in shows and parades at Walt Disney World, and danced for Universal from 2013-2014. Jessica has choreographed and produced numerous films, music videos, and theatre programs across the US. Jessica is passionate about sharing stories and connecting with others through her choreography and instruction.
